#1607e0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1607e0 is composed of 8.6% red, 2.7% green and 87.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.2% cyan, 96.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.2% black. It has a hue angle of 244.1 degrees, a saturation of 93.9% and a lightness of 45.3%. #1607e0 color hex could be obtained by blending #2c0eff with #0000c1. Closest websafe color is: #0000cc.

Shades and Tints of #1607e0
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#01000f is the darkest color, while #fbfbff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1607e0
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#727275 is the less saturated color, while #1607e0 is the most saturated one.
